CVE-2026-24030
DNSdist (DNS load balancer) has a vulnerability CVE-2026-24030 where processing DNS over QUIC or DNS over HTTP/3 payloads may allocate unbounded memory, potentially causing denial of service and, in some cases, an out-of-memory state. CVE-2026-24029
CVE-2026-24029 affects a DNS-over-HTTPS frontend using the nghttp2 provider. When the early_acl_drop (earlyACLDrop in Lua) option is disabled, the ACL check is skipped, permitting all clients to issue DoH queries regardless of the configured ACL. CVE-2026-24028
CVE-2026-24028 affects dnsdist, a DNS load balancer. The issue arises when custom Lua code parses DNS packets with newDNSPacketOverlay, causing an out-of-bounds read that can crash the process and potentially disclose memory. CVE-2025-41357 Reflected Cross-Site Scripting on Anon Proxy Server
Reflected Cross-Site Scripting XSS vulnerability in Anon Proxy Server v0.104. This vulnerability allows an attacker to execute JavaScript code in the victim's browser by sending him/her a malicious URL.
